Dolphin Species


All dolphin species are marine mammals belonging to the toothed whales (Odontoceti).

Dolphins eat mostly fish and squid, they very in size between 1.2 for the smallest, Hector's dolphin (Cephalorhynchus hectori) at about 40kg to the largest and very powerful Orca (killer whale) at up to 9.5meters and 10 tonnes.

Oceanic dolphin (Orca).

We can distinguish between freshwater dolphins and saltwater (oceanic) dolphins. Oceanic dolphins belong to the family delphinidae. Freshwater dolphins comprise four families with only one species each: Iniidae, Pontoporiidae, Lipotidae and Platanistidae.
